Moderate Recalled June 27, 2008 About 16,500 units Updated May 23, 2014

E-Z-GO Recalls RXV Golf Cars Due to Fall Hazard

The hazard

The hip restraints on the cars can detach at the base, posing a fall and injury risk to consumers.

Incidents reported: E-Z-GO has received 20 reports of hip restraints breaking, including nine reports of broken bones and abrasions from falls.

What to do now

Consumers should contact the nearest E-Z-GO dealer to arrange for a free repair. E-Z-GO and E-Z-GO dealers are contacting known owners.

About this recall

This recall involves electric and gasoline-powered Fleet RXV, Freedom RXV and RXV Shuttle 2+2 golf cars. The model names and the E-Z-GO logo are printed on the sides and front panel of all three vehicles. Serial numbers ranging from 9300001 to 9300188 and 5000000 to 5021328 are printed on a plate attached to the steering column, and the front and rear frames.
